- Right-click desktop → NVIDIA Control Panel.
- Go to Manage 3D Settings → Program Settings tab.
- Click Add → browse to
CoD2SP_s.exe. - Set "Preferred graphics processor" to "High-performance NVIDIA processor".
- Apply and restart the game.
